253,138 SF Grocery-Anchored Center | Kroger Backed Food 4 Less | Crest Hill, IL (Chicago MSA)

Marketing description

CBRE’s National Retail Partners is pleased to present as the exclusive advisor, Hillcrest Shopping Center, a 253,138 square foot grocery-anchored center located in Crest Hill, IL, a southwest suburb just north of Joliet and 40 miles from downtown Chicago. The Property is anchored by Food 4 Less (a Kroger concept), and home to national tenants such as Dollar Tree, Harbor Freight Tools and Citi Trends. The Property also features a diverse mix of specialty tenants. Hillcrest Shopping Center features value-add opportunities with significant value coming from the ability to mark rents to market on expiring tenants. The Property also contains 9,775 square feet of vacancy, allowing a future owner to step in and lease-up available space. The Property has experienced significant leasing momentum, with the most recent example being Smoothie King signing a 10-year lease in 2025.

Hillcrest Shopping Center is highly visible from the signalized intersection of Larkin Road and Plainfield Avenue with traffic counts exceeding 47,500 VPD. The Property is also approximately 3 miles south of Interstate 55 which sees over 60,000 vehicles per day. The Property serves a dense trade area with over 142,000 residents earning an average household income of $86,808. According to Placer.ai, Hillcrest Shopping Center ranked in the top 25 percent of shopping centers nationwide with over 2 million visits in 2024. Furthermore, Harbor Freight is the #1 store within a 15-mile radius and Dollar Tree is in the 30th percentile for its chain nationwide.

Investment highlights

Kroger Backed Food 4 Less Anchor: The center is anchored by a Kroger backed Food 4 Less that is in the top 20th percentile of all groceries within Illinois and 21st percentile of groceries within a 15-mile radius according to Placer.ai.

Mark to Market Opportunity: The Property is nearly 100% occupied yet CBRE believes there are numerous tenants paying below market rents, thus generating an estimated NOI CAGR of 3.80%. The mark to market opportunity offers an investor a unique opportunity to significantly grow NOI while limiting downtime and capital costs via renewals with existing tenants.

Lease Up Opportunity: Ownership has the potential to increase NOI by leasing up 9,775 available square feet. Future ownership can benefit from the recent leasing momentum and can continue with that kind of success.

Recent Leasing Momentum Highlighting Underlying Real Estate Fundamentals: Hillcrest Shopping Center has experienced tremendous leasing momentum within the past three years with brand-new leases signed totaling 6,988 square feet.
